Understanding the Unisoc T618 chipset

The Unisoc T618 is a cutting-edge 8-core processor made for mid-range tablets. It combines two powerful Cortex-A75 cores with six energy-saving Cortex-A55 cores. This mix boosts tablet performance for gaming and emulation.

With a Mali-G52 MP2 GPU, the T618 offers strong graphics capabilities. It’s perfect for running games like Metroid Prime 3. This makes it great for retro gaming on tablets, offering a smooth experience.

Optimizing your Android 11 tablet settings

To boost your gaming and overall tablet performance, start by tweaking Android 11 settings. Here’s what to do:

  • Enable Developer Options: Go to Settings > About Tablet, find the Build Number, and tap it seven times to unlock Developer Options.
  • Adjust Animation Scales: In Settings > Developer Options, lower Window, Transition, and Animator durations to 0.5x or turn them off.
  • Limit Background Processes: Under Developer Options, set Background Process Limit to 2 or 3 to prevent apps from using too many resources.

Common Gameplay Issues and Solutions

When playing Metroid Prime 3, users might face issues like lag, stuttering, and audio problems. Finding the cause is key to solving these problems. We’ll share tips to fix these issues and improve your gaming experience.

Performance issues and fixes

Performance problems can ruin the fun. Here are some common issues and how to fix them:

  • Lag during gameplay: Try lowering graphics settings. Changing internal resolution and disabling enhancements can help keep the game smooth.
  • Stuttering: Close background apps to free up resources. Also, make Dolphin MMJ a priority in your device manager for better performance.
  • Long load times: Slow storage can cause delays. Switch to a faster SD card or internal storage to speed things up.

Audio glitches and how to resolve them

Audio issues can ruin the game’s atmosphere. Here’s how to fix common audio problems:

  • Audio stuttering or cutting out: Change the audio backend to match your system. Try OpenAL or other supported options.
  • Desynchronized audio: Make sure the game’s frame rate matches your audio settings. Enabling audio stretching can help sync audio and gameplay.
  • Missing sound effects: Update your emulator and check for patches. They might fix missing audio.

Exploring Graphics Settings in Dolphin

The graphics settings in Dolphin emulator are key to a better gaming experience. Users can tweak various options to balance visual quality and performance.

Adjustments like antialiasing help smooth out jagged edges. This makes games like Metroid Prime 3 look better. Anisotropic filtering also improves texture clarity at sharp angles, making scenes more realistic.

Resolution scaling lets users play games at higher resolutions than they were made for. This can greatly enhance Metroid Prime 3’s visuals, but only if your device can handle it.
